What costs are involved in renting a property?

0

A security deposit will have to be paid to the landlord. This is usually between 1 to 2 months rent, refundable upon exit when all utility bills arrive and have been paid. At times, landlords require a ‘Fiador’ or ‘Guarantor’ besides the security deposit. The first rental payment will also have to be paid to the landlord. Rent is usually due monthly but landlords can dictate how they wish to be paid. If a holding deposit has been made along with an Oferta, the sum is deducted from the above payments to the landlord.
